Rules For Bonuses And Limits On Betting Explained

How the bonus works: There are certain rules that must be followed in order to get promotional credits when you sign up, make a deposit, or take part in special campaigns. These details are on every offer page, but they are different for each type of promotion. Always read the attached terms and conditions before accepting a reward so you know who is eligible and what the withdrawal limits are.

Wagering Multipliers:

Most offers require users to bet the promotional funds a certain number of times–commonly noted as a multiplier (for example, 25x, 35x, or 50x the bonus amount). Only bets that meet the requirements count towards reaching this goal. Check the contribution rates for each game. For example, slot machines usually give 100%, but table games and video poker may give much less or not at all.

Restricted Activities:

Making bets with no risk or structuring bets to go over the maximum allowed stakes will cancel active offers. If you abuse reward campaigns by making multiple accounts or working together, your credits will be taken away and your account may be suspended.

Validity Period:

Each promotional credit comes with a set expiration window, typically ranging from 7 to 30 days, within which all criteria must be satisfied. Unused portions or unmet requirements at the end of the period result in expiry, and all associated winnings are forfeit.

Maximum Bonus Conversion:

Some credits impose a ceiling on the maximum amount convertible to real funds relative to the initial bonus, regardless of earnings generated during play. For example, a 100 $ reward may cap total withdrawal at 500 $ unless specified otherwise in the offer.

Withdrawal Lock:

You may not be able to withdraw $ from your balance until the required turnover is finished, or it may cancel the promotional credit and any winnings that go along with it. To avoid losing your money by accident, always check your progress in the account dashboard.

Limitations By Country:

Users from Canada may not be able to use certain campaigns or promotional credits, or they may have to meet extra requirements. The full details of each promotion make these restrictions clear. Before using any offer, customers should check to see if it is still available.

Best Practices:

To get the most out of a promotion, read all the rules carefully. To stay eligible, keep an eye on your bonus balance and qualifying play, play games with higher contribution rates when you can, and stay away from activities that are off-limits.

Changes To The Table: Baccarat, Roulette, And Blackjack

There are many different versions of blackjack, each with its own rules for splitting, doubling down, surrendering, and payout ratios (usually 3:2, but check for games with different house edges). You can't count cards, and doing so could get you in trouble with your account. There are both American (double zero) and European (single zero) versions of roulette. Different tables have different betting limits. Only certain versions of "En Prison" and "La Partage" rules apply. Always check the information shown before betting real money. In baccarat, the limits on how much players and bankers can bet are different. Different side bets, like "Dragon Bonus" or "Tie," may have different contribution rates for bonus playthrough.

Slot Mechanics And Rules

Limits on how much you can bet per spin can affect whether you can get a bonus. When you bet on a bonus, spinning on some slots might not count, or it might only count for a small amount (like 20–80%). The promotions section has information about the different contribution rates. Progressive jackpot slots require the maximum eligible stake for a chance to win the pooled prize. You might not be able to win jackpots if you bet with bonus credits that have restrictions. Changing or using automated tools, like auto-spinners that the provider doesn't include, is not allowed at all. If you break the rules, you could lose your winnings. The rules of the base title still apply to special rounds like "free spins" or bonus pick features. If you win these, you may have to play through them again, especially if you used promotional credits to do so.

There are certain rules of behaviour and betting speed that you need to follow in live dealer rooms. Attending users should place wagers within set timeframes. Repeated inactivity or disruptive behavior may lead to removal from the game session without compensation. Poker tournaments have their own TDA (Tournament Directors Association) rules. Multi-accounting or chip-dumping will result in disqualification and possible forfeiture of $ balance. Responsible Gaming: Setting Limits And Self-exclusion Options

Responsible gaming measures empower Canadian users to control their experience and minimize risks. This section details effective strategies to manage play, with a focus on setting personal boundaries and self-exclusion functionalities.

Personal Limits: Manage Your Spending And Time

Account holders can adjust parameters to restrict their own activities. There are tools available, such as:

Type of Limit Description How to Set a Limit
Deposits Set a limit on how much money you can deposit each day, week, or month. Go to the payments section of your profile settings and change your upper limit to what you want.
Length of Session Set a limit on the number of hours in a row that can be spent playing to lower the risk of too much activity. Change the session controls in your account dashboard to set a maximum amount of time you can play without stopping.
Bet Limit Set the highest amount of $ that can be committed in a certain amount of time. To set a threshold, go to the responsible gaming settings.

Depending on the settings, limits take effect right away or the next time you log in. There is a mandatory cooling-off period before changes can be made to increase or remove boundaries. This stops people from making changes on a whim.

Self-exclusion: Block Access Ahead Of Time

Users can choose to use self-exclusion protocols if they need stronger action. This feature blocks access to the gaming platform for a set amount of time, like 24 hours, 7 days, 30 days, or even forever.

What happens during the self-exclusion period How to Turn On
Short-term (24 to 72 hours) All gaming features are temporarily turned off, and log-in is limited. You can turn it on in the responsible gaming menu in your profile area.
In the medium term (7 to 30 days) You can't place bets, make deposits, or request withdrawals at all. To apply, either call customer service or use the automated account tools.
Forever Complete loss of access to the account; reinstatement only after a formal review. Send a formal request to the support team, and they will write back to you to confirm your choice.

Your remaining $ in your balance are safe during self-exclusion. You can still process withdrawal requests, but you can't make new accounts or undo exclusions without going through a full review first. For Canadian users, using these features can help them have fun while also lowering their stress levels and financial strain. There are support contacts and tools on the platform to help you more.
